The 13th Monaco Sportsboat Winter Series, organised by Yacht Club de Monaco, got off to a fast-paced start 6-9 November, with three days of back-to-back racing for the J/70s. The 23 teams faced tactical challenges during eight races in changeable conditions. The suspense was short-lived with G-Spot, helmed by YCM’s Giangiacomo Serena di Lapigio, taking control to win five of the eight races. Relentlessly consistent in all conditions, they finished nine points ahead of the Italians on Alice. The French on Euro-Voiles completed the podium. Gaps between the top ten behind them are minimal, just one poor result could upset the overall rankings.Euro-Voiles was the Corinthian winner, ahead of the Swiss on Tarte-3Nuits.com and Rhubarbe-3Nuits.com. The J/70 Monaco Class Association is one of the largest fleets in the Mediterranean, with ten of the 17-strong fleet competing this weekend. Optimal conditions helped visiting teams anticipate gusts and take advantage of what is recognised as an ideal training ground for practicing manoeuvres and starts, and testing equipment and crew configurations, in race conditions ahead of the season’s major events).
